Hundreds of people gathered at a school gym in Richfield, Minnesota, for a solemn vigil following a tragic shooting at a Catholic church in nearby Minneapolis. The gunman, identified as 23-year-old Robin Westman, opened fire during a church service, killing two children and injuring 17 others before taking his own life.
Archbishop Bernard Hebda praised the courage and love displayed by the students who tried to shield their classmates during the violent incident. Witnesses described the terrifying moments when the gunshots rang out, with children and parishioners hiding and trying to protect each other.
Authorities are investigating the shooting as an act of domestic terrorism and a hate crime targeting Catholics. The motive behind the attack remains unclear, although a social media post and videos posted by the shooter suggest possible extremist views.
The tragic event has left the community in shock and mourning, with authorities and religious leaders emphasizing the need for unity and support for the victims and their families. The bravery of the children and the quick response of law enforcement have been highlighted as sources of hope in the midst of tragedy.
